1 Does not wisdom call out? Does not understanding raise her voice? |
2 On the heights along the way, where the paths meet, she takes her stand; |
3 beside the gates leading into the city, at the entrances, she cries aloud: |
4 "To you, O men, I call out; I raise my voice to all mankind. |
5 You who are simple, gain prudence; you who are foolish, gain understanding. |
6 Listen, for I have worthy things to say; I open my lips to speak what is right. |
7 My mouth speaks what is true, for my lips detest wickedness. |
8 All the words of my mouth are just; none of them is crooked or perverse. |
9 To the discerning all of them are right; they are faultless to those who have knowledge. |
10 Choose my instruction instead of silver, knowledge rather than choice gold, |
11 for wisdom is more precious than rubies, and nothing you desire can compare with her. |
12 "I, wisdom, dwell together with prudence; I possess knowledge and discretion. |
13 To fear the LORD is to hate evil; I hate pride and arrogance, evil behavior and perverse speech. |
14 Counsel and sound judgment are mine; I have understanding and power. |
15 By me kings reign and rulers make laws that are just; |
16 by me princes govern, and all nobles who rule on earth. |
17 I love those who love me, and those who seek me find me. |
18 With me are riches and honor, enduring wealth and prosperity. |
19 My fruit is better than fine gold; what I yield surpasses choice silver. |
20 I walk in the way of righteousness, along the paths of justice, |
21 bestowing wealth on those who love me and making their treasuries full. |
22 "The LORD brought me forth as the first of his works, before his deeds of old; |
23 I was appointed from eternity, from the beginning, before the world began. |
24 When there were no oceans, I was given birth, when there were no springs abounding with water; |
25 before the mountains were settled in place, before the hills, I was given birth, |
26 before he made the earth or its fields or any of the dust of the world. |
27 I was there when he set the heavens in place, when he marked out the horizon on the face of the deep, |
28 when he established the clouds above and fixed securely the fountains of the deep, |
29 when he gave the sea its boundary so the waters would not overstep his command, and when he marked out the foundations of the earth. |
30 Then I was the craftsman at his side. I was filled with delight day after day, rejoicing always in his presence, |
31 rejoicing in his whole world and delighting in mankind. |
32 "Now then, my sons, listen to me; blessed are those who keep my ways. |
33 Listen to my instruction and be wise; do not ignore it. |
34 Blessed is the man who listens to me, watching daily at my doors, waiting at my doorway. |
35 For whoever finds me finds life and receives favor from the LORD. |
36 But whoever fails to find me harms himself; all who hate me love death." |
